Nearby
If you’re looking to explore a bit beyond Bull Bay, there are plenty of great spots within a 10-mile radius that make for ideal day trips. Just a short drive south, you’ll find Amlwch, a charming harbour town with a fascinating history tied to the copper mining industry. The Copper Kingdom Centre here offers an interactive look at the area’s mining heritage, with trails leading to the historic Parys Mountain, where colourful landscapes and old mine workings make for a unique hike.
For a change of scenery, head west to Cemaes Bay, a lovely seaside village with sandy beaches, perfect for family beach days and a stroll through the village. Or venture down to Benllech Beach, known for its golden sands and shallow waters—ideal for swimming, beachcombing, or just soaking up the sun.
Nature lovers will enjoy Traeth Lligwy, a broad sandy beach a bit farther south, where you can spot local wildlife and enjoy panoramic views of the coastline. And if you fancy a bit of island history, the ancient Lligwy Burial Chamber and Din Lligwy Roman ruins are nearby, offering a glimpse into Wales’ ancient past.
